Introduction
Glencore South Africa has opened applications for its Cadet Training Programme 2026, offering entry-level mining industry exposure for applicants with a Grade 10 qualification. The programme is based in Steelpoort and is aimed at motivated candidates who are medically fit and interested in developing practical mining workplace skills.

Minimum Requirements
Applicants must have:
- Grade 10 qualification
- Medical fitness for work
- Ability to communicate in English
- Good interpersonal skills
- Ability to work with others
- Willingness to learn
- Initiative and responsibility
These requirements are important because mining environments depend heavily on safety, communication, and teamwork.

How to Apply
Applications must be submitted via email.
Email Address:
ecmskillsdevelopment@glencore.co.za
Recommended Subject Line:
Application for Cadet Training Programme – Mining
Applicants should attach:
- Updated CV
- Certified qualification copies
- Certified ID copy
